Driving safely on icy roads

The winter has officially begun, and that means that we have to prepare ourselves for cold days and icy roads. We’re happy to share some tips so you can stay safe on a slippery road.

  1. Adjust your speed so that you can better anticipate what is happening around you. Secondly, your braking distance is a lot greater on an icy road compared to a dry one. By reducing your speed, you can prevent ending up against the rear bumper of the car in front of you.
  2. For those same reasons, it is advised to keep sufficient distance between you and the car in front.

Avoid fines during your travels

Summer is still in full swing and an opportunity for a trip abroad cannot be missed. We all understand that when at our destination, we must comply with the local traffic rules. However, these following rules can also hurt your wallet quite a bit!

Slip-free in France and Spain

Do you live in your slippers during your journey south? Well, throw a pair of sneakers in the trunk anyway. Anyone caught wearing slippers while driving in France or Spain will be heavily fined. The police will also be happy to charge you for wearing earphones in the car.

Planning a car trip to France, Italy or Spain? Don't forget to take these!

Summer has really started and for many Belgians that means travelling to warmer places. Will you travel by car to France, Italy or Spain this year? Here you will find a checklist of the things that you are required to take with you.

Obligations as a result of corona

This summer it is better you throw in a mouth mask in your suitcase. Wearing a mask is mandatory in many places in France, Italy and Spain - such as museums, supermarkets, souvenir shops, shopping malls and restaurants.
